Understanding Income Protection Limits: What's Available to You

When facing economic hardship, income protection can be a vital safety net. However, it's essential to fully understand the restrictions that apply to these policies. Income protection plans typically provide a percentage of your typical income in case you become unwell or incapable to work due to an unforeseen event. The figure you can obtain is often restricted by your policy's terms and conditions, as well as governing factors.

  • Exploring your specific policy documents is crucial to assess the precise extent of your income protection benefits.
  • Elements like your age, occupation, health history, and chosen benefit period can all influence the degree of coverage you're eligible for.
  • Seeking advice from a qualified financial advisor can be beneficial in navigating these complex aspects and choosing a policy that best suits your individual needs.
